The soviets demands
west should recognise GDR, withdraw troops from West Berlin and hand in access routes to east German government
Khrushchev ultimatum
Nov 1958 demanded 3 western powers withdraw from city in 6 months to create demilitarised state; USA did not accept . spy plane to take images of east in 1960, and US spy plane shot down by Soviets
April 1961 30,000 people left the GDR
June 1961
Vienna Summit
K pressurised US Kennedy to withdraw western forces from west berlin within 6 months
Kennedy promised to protect West Berlin
July 17th 1961
west rejcted K's demands
July 23rd 1961
East imposed strict travel restrictions
up to 1000 refugees had been leaving a day
July 25th 1961
Kennedy gave further garuntees to west berlin and announced increased arms spending
August 13th 1961
barbed wire went along border of east and west
august 22nd 1961
all routes to west closed except checkpoint charlie
October 1961
US diplomats crossed into east to test soviet reaction
27th oct Soviet tanks arrived at checkpoint Charlie to refuse access to east berlin
